Godage and Brothers (Pvt) Ltd, Maradana<\/strong><\/p>\n<p>Many are the works of fiction, some by world famous writers such as D.H.Lawrence, on the subject of Jesus. Yet this book is one with a difference. It seeks to unravel the enigma that was Jesus of Nazareth by a probe into his subconscious mind, the latent ever simmering mirror of the innermost self from which the external visible entity derives its form and existence on the passing scene of time.<\/p>\n<p>While being essentially imaginative, the book incorporates a vast process of thought which includes philosophy, theology, biblical knowledge, insights from world religions, as well as ancient and recent history, in its narrative. Its motive is not to reinforce the belief of a particular religions denomination but to present a unique world religious figure in a manner that transcends religious, racial, cultural and historical horizons.<\/p>\n<p>The Jesus of this book is not the historical person the Catholic and the Christian Churches propose to believers, but one who grapples with his identity and mission from within a fertile mind field related more to mythology than to history. Such a phenomenon is not limited by space and time. What transpires within it is uninterrupted and ongoing. For not a moment is the subconscious mind inactive. It is permanently plugged to the memory and imagination, and its domain is the realm of dreams. This subconscious mind of Jesus, the book proposes, is one that derives its vitality from three different sources: Jewish, Egyptian and Indian. From within these fields, as remembrances of an ancient past and\u00a0 visions of a distant future, the hidden testament of Jesus emerges and evolves, unhindered by physical and mental barriers.<\/p>\n<p>However the predominant quintessential element that permeates the subconscious mind of Jesus, giving meaning to his existence and mission, is the sacred feminine. Without it, points out the book, Jesus is a void and empty apparition, a form without a soul. This work therefore unambiguously asserts that woman is the primordial being of the manifest world, the surrogate form of the Earth, the primeval life giving force that pervades both womb and tomb, out of which everything, including the personification of the divine issues, and into which everything returns to reemerge anew. The divine feminine thereby emerges as the indispensable key in determining the real identity, mission and destiny of the man Jesus of Nazareth.<\/p>\n<p>This is a truly unique work. It challenges the reader to surmount indoctrination and fear in the search for the truth, a truth which essentially, unequivocally and unquestionably is individual and personal.<\/p>\n<p>Dr. Juanita REETZ Ph.D. University of Rochester, New York.
